
From ‘Dholi Taro Dhol Baaje’ of Hum Dil De Chuke Sanam to 'Dola Re Dola' of Devdas, Bollywood songs have continued to dominate the music scene during Navratri celebrations. This year too, the festival saw people dance and sing until the wee hours of the night. Here are few amazing pictures of dance enthusiasts who deserve a round of applause for their garba moves.
